Peddler’s Mall Re-Opens

The Peddler Mall is a flea market style business housed inside the old Wal-mart building. Independent vendors rent booths inside to sell whatever products they wish. The building stood empty for many years after the new Super Center was built while Wal-mart maintained ownership of it. In 2005, The first owner was evicted after he failed to pay his rent then a husband and wife couple opted to take over the lease and try to keep it open. The Merchant’s mall closed again some months later but now it appears Wal-mart is making another attempt.

Here’s to the future success of the new Peddler’s Mall.
